The convention in verse 19 corresponds to saying in modern trigonometry that sin 90 + θ = cos θ sin (180 — θ) sin θ, sin 180 + θ = — sin θ, sin 270 — θ = — cos θ sin 270 + θ = — cos θ, sin 360 — θ = — sin θ. In Hindu trigonometry the sign is understood and not explicitly mentioned. Krāntijyā, Dyujyā, Drig-jyā and Śaṅku, are respecti- vely H sin δ, H cos δ, H sin Z, H cos Z where δ is decli- nation and Z the Zenith-distance of a celestial body. Taking the radius of the celertial equator to be R, the radius of the diurnal circle of a celestial would be equal to R × cos δ = H cos δ which is called Dyujyā because it is the radius of the diurnal circle. Verse 22. The lengths of the circumferences of the Manda—epicycles are respectively 13° — 40', 31° — 36', 70°, 38°, 33°, 50,* for the Sun, Moon, Mars, Mercury, Jupiter, Venus and Saturn. Comm. Bhāskara has given these measures reportedly on the basis of Āgama or ancient authority. The peculiarity of measuring the circumferences in degrees less than 360°, is due to the idea that these circumstances are measured in relation to that of the deferent or Kakshā Vritta taken to be 360°. In other words, circumference of the epicycle of a planet as given above : circumference of the mean orbit :: x : 360 = radius of the epicycle : radius of the mean orbit where x is the measure of the circumference of the planet- ary epicycle.
